AGRA: The state government has sanctioned Rs 64.94 crore for building a civil terminal for Agra airport , said Agra divisional commissioner K Rammohan Rao on Monday.According to the official, the work in this regard will start from the first week of July.For the proposed civil terminal 23.32 hectare land was to be acquired. So far, around 14.07 hectare has been acquired and a sum of Rs 84.71 crore has already been spent for this purpose. The administration has sought Rs 64.94 crore more to acquire the remaining land and it has been sanctioned now, said Rao."It is a big achievement for the city. With the terminal in place, we will be able to provide better facilities to tourists coming here," the senior official added.Even as there has been an overall surge in air traffic movement across the country with the number of passengers opting for flights rising over the years, a reverse trend has been witnessed in Agra, which sees the arrival of over one crore tourists from across the globe every year. According to Airports Authority of India data, the number of flights landing in Agra has gone down by half, while the number of air passengers by one-third over the last 17 years.At present, the airport terminal is located within the premises of the Air Force building. This not only makes the operation of flights difficult but also imposes restrictions on free movement of passengers. The state government has announced to build a civil enclave across 23 hectare in Dhanauli village in 2012.
